Which photo should be kept in living room?

Pictures of gods, gurus or waterfalls should be hung in the north-east corner. Pictures of birds or running horses are best displayed in the north-west section of the room. It's always recommended to have a water fountain, water feature or fish tank in the north-east corner of the living room. 5.

Where do you keep god pictures?

Be it a temple, a pooja room, a wall-mounted temple or any other corner of the house being used as a pooja corner, the best direction to keep god photos or the idols is the east or the north, as the person who is performing pooja, must not face the south direction. God photos or idols must not be kept on the floor.

What should not be kept in puja room?

According to pooja room Vastu , a home should not have any God or Goddess's idol that is more than nine inches in height. Avoid keeping in the temple at home Gods photos related to war, in which the form of God is angry. Always keep idols of God with gentle, peaceful and blessed posture for positive energy.

What gods should be kept in pooja room?

Vastu Rules To Keep Idols In The Pooja Room

Brahma, Vishnu, Mahesh, Kartikeya, Indra, Surya. 2. The idols of gods that need to placed in the north, facing the south direction are: Ganesh, Durga, Shodas, Matrika, Kuber, Bhairav.
